高性能云服务器租用测试的重要性
在云计算时代,高性能云服务器已经成为企业和个人用户部署应用、搭建网站的首选,面对市场上众多的云服务器提供商,如何选择一款性价比高、性能优越的服务器呢?这时候,对高性能云服务器进行充分的测试就显得尤为重要,本文将从以下几个方面介绍如何测试高性能云服务器:硬件性能、网络性能、稳定性和安全性。
硬件性能测试
1、CPU性能测试
CPU是服务器的核心部件,其性能直接影响到服务器的整体运行速度,可以通过运行一些性能测试软件,如Cinebench、Geekbench等,来评估服务器的CPU性能,还可以关注服务器所采用的CPU型号,如Intel Xeon、AMD EPYC等高端处理器,以确保服务器具备较强的计算能力。
2、内存性能测试
内存是服务器运行过程中频繁访问的资源,因此内存性能对服务器的运行速度有很大影响,可以使用Memtest86+等内存检测工具,对服务器的内存进行压力测试,以评估其稳定性和可靠性,关注服务器的内存类型(如DDR4、DDR5等)和容量,以满足不同应用场景的需求。
3、硬盘性能测试
硬盘是服务器存储数据的主要设备,其性能直接影响到数据的读写速度,可以使用HD Tune、CrystalDiskMark等硬盘性能测试工具,对服务器的硬盘进行读写速度、延迟等方面的测试,还需关注硬盘的类型(如SATA、SAS、NVMe等)和容量,以满足不同应用场景的需求。
4、GPU性能测试
对于需要大量图形处理的任务(如视频编辑、游戏等),GPU性能至关重要,可以使用CUDA-Z、3DMark等GPU性能测试工具,对服务器的GPU进行压力测试和性能评估,关注服务器所采用的GPU品牌和型号,如NVIDIA Tesla、AMD Radeon等,以确保具备较强的图形处理能力。
网络性能测试
1、带宽测试
带宽是衡量服务器网络性能的重要指标,可以通过Ping命令、iperf等工具,对服务器的上行和下行带宽进行测试,还需关注服务器所提供的网络线路类型(如电信、联通、移动等)和带宽速率,以满足不同应用场景的需求。
2、延迟测试
延迟是指数据在传输过程中从发送端到接收端所需的时间,可以使用Traceroute、MTR等延迟测试工具,对服务器的网络连接进行延迟测试,以评估其网络性能,还需关注服务器所处地理位置和网络环境,以确保具备较低的延迟水平。
稳定性测试
1、系统稳定性测试
系统稳定性是指服务器在长时间运行过程中是否出现故障或异常,可以通过持续运行一些稳定的服务(如Web服务、数据库服务等),观察服务器是否出现卡顿、死机等问题,还可以通过查看服务器的日志文件,分析其中的错误信息,以判断系统是否存在潜在问题。
2、电源稳定性测试
电源稳定性是指服务器在突然断电或电压波动等情况时,是否能够正常启动并保持稳定运行,可以使用电源监控软件(如HWMonitor、Prime95等),对服务器的电源进行监控和评估,还需关注服务器所采用的电源类型(如ATX、SFX等)和功率供应,以确保具备良好的电源稳定性。
安全性测试
1、端口扫描测试
端口扫描是一种常见的安全威胁检测方法,可以通过使用Nmap等工具,对服务器的开放端口进行扫描,以发现潜在的安全漏洞,还需关注服务器所使用的防火墙技术和端口管理策略,以提高安全性。
2、SQL注入漏洞测试
SQL注入是一种常见的网络攻击手段,可以通过在Web表单中输入恶意SQL代码,获取数据库中的敏感信息,可以使用sqlmap等工具,对服务器进行SQL注入漏洞测试,以发现潜在的安全风险,还需加强Web应用的安全防护措施,如使用预编译语句、限制用户输入长度等。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/165475.html